Who is Alicia Menendez?
Alicia Menendez has built a respected career in media, working with major news outlets such as MSNBC and CNN. She often covers political and social issues, bringing a unique perspective to her reporting. As a Latina journalist, she is often asked about her proficiency in Spanish, given its importance in the Latino community.
Does Alicia Menendez Speak Spanish?
Yes, Alicia Menendez does speak Spanish. While she might not always showcase her Spanish-speaking skills on air, she has acknowledged her ability to speak the language. Her connection to her Cuban-American heritage plays a role in her linguistic capabilities.
